The Anatomy of Iceland 2. Deild: Key Insights
-
League Structure: The 2. Deild represents the third level of Icelandic football, featuring 12 ambitious clubs striving either for promotion to 1. Deild or to stave off relegation.
-
Format: Teams play each other twice—home and away—throughout the regular season, creating a fast-paced competition where every match alters the table dynamics.
-
Youth and Experience: Many squads blend fresh local talent with seasoned campaigners, often resulting in unpredictable, high-scoring affairs.
